Summary

From Cleaning Rental Shoes to Chief Operating Officer 👠📦 We sit down with Amanda, the COO of our day job, a mother of five (including one-year-old twins), and the woman who can move 10,000 boxes while managing a “stroller blowout.” The Highlights: The Tuxedo Trauma: The specific item found in a rental pant leg that made Amanda vow to own the company one day. The Imposter Syndrome Sprint: How she led Product Development without a design degree by “optimizing the process” instead of the art. Warehouse vs. Toddlers: Why getting five kids into a car is officially harder than managing a 300,000 sq. ft. peak-season shipping floor. The $700 iPad Accident: What happens when your kid thinks “Delete” means “Refund.” The Challenge: Stop second-guessing. Say your goal out loud this week and push for it. As Amanda says: “You can have it all.”
